Today would have been the 77th Birthday of  New York City born  jazz trumpeter, composer and actor, Lew Soloff, best known for his work with psychedelic jazz rock group, Blood, Sweat, & Tears. He passed away in 2015, age 71, from a heart attack. "You've Made Me So Very Happy", a cover of Brenda Holloway's 1967 song, was released by Blood, Sweat, & Tears in 1969 on the Columbia label. The song, hailing from their self titled second album reached #35 in the UK, #18 on the Adult Contemporary charts, and #2 on the Hot 100. The tune, "Blues Part II" from the same LP, is featured on the B-side.

David Clayton-Thomas – lead vocals except as noted


Steve Katz – guitar, harmonica, vocals, lead vocals on "Sometimes In Winter"


Jim Fielder – bass
Dick Halligan – organ, piano, flute, trombone, vocals
Fred Lipsius – alto saxophone, piano


Lew Soloff – trumpet, flugelhorn
Chuck Winfield – trumpet, flugelhorn
Alan Rubin - trumpet on "Spinning Wheel"


Jerry Hyman – trombone, recorder
Bobby Colomby – drums, percussion, vocals

Our second selection comes to us via New York state jazz rock band, Steely Dan. Today would have been the co-founder, guitarist, bassist, and co-songwriter, Walter Becker's 71st Birthday. He passed away in 2017, age 67, from esophageal cancer. Their song, "FM (No Static at All)" was released in 1978 on the MCA label, and saw the soundtrack album to the film FM, as it's parent record. The track reached #49 in the UK, #24 on the Cash Box, and #22 on the Hot 100. "FM (No Static at All) - Reprise" is on the B-side.

Donald Fagen: vocals, piano
Walter Becker: electric guitar, bass
Jeff Porcaro: drums, percussion
Victor Feldman: percussion
Pete Christlieb: tenor saxophone
Glenn Frey, Don Henley, Tim Schmit: backing vocals
Johnny Mandel: string arrangements
